Bear Gulch Cave Trail, High Peaks Trail and Condor Gulch Trail Loop
The Bear Gulch Cave, High Peaks, and Condor Gulch trails offer a breathtaking loop through Pinnacles National Park, showcasing its striking volcanic formations, unique wildlife, and sweeping vistas. As you hike, you'll traverse narrow canyons, rocky spires, and expansive views, with the possibility of spotting California condors soaring overhead. The route also takes you through the eerie Bear Gulch Caves, where visitors can explore cool, dimly lit passages while observing the park's diverse geology and vibrant flora. #Hiking #Mountain #Nature #Loop #Cave
- Distance: 8.7 Km
- Elevation gain: 492 m
- Maximum elevation: 782 m
- Elevation loss: 493 m
- Minimum elevation: 395 m
